Citizen and Versa folding bikes

I'm seeing these selling for pretty low prices in used condition and can't help but wonder if any of these two brands make quality folding bikes? I am possible getting into folding bikes because my workplace won't allow a full-sized bike to be brought inside. Any help would be appreciated

i perused the available options in your area. honestly, based on my experience, i think you would be better off getting this dahon classic. dahon classics are very well made and durable. comes stock with a sturmey archer AW 3 speed internal gear hub. the seller says it was only ridden a few times. if that's true it could be a great find for 100. plus, it comes with a bag.
